Visiting a university before applying is important because it lets you experience the campus first-hand. You can see facilities, meet academics and students, and get a feel for the academic programs and culture of each - and they can be very different from what you expected. Attending multiple Open Days helps you decide which is the right fit for you and make a more informed decision about your future. Click here for dates.
